Drying
The veneer drying process is the production stage in which thin wood sheets coming out of the peeling phase are dried under controlled conditions and brought to the optimum moisture level. Drying is a decisive stage in terms of the quality, durability, and bonding strength of the final product.
Why Is Drying Necessary?
Fresh veneer sheets coming out of the peeling process contain high amounts of moisture. Although this moisture content varies depending on the wood species and season, it generally exceeds fifty percent. Veneer sheets with high moisture content cannot be directly subjected to gluing and pressing; because excess moisture prevents the adhesive from penetrating properly, moisture that evaporates during pressing causes blistering and delamination in the panel, and the dimensional stability of the final plywood panel is compromised. Through the drying process, the moisture content is reduced to between 6% and 8%, preparing the veneer sheets for the gluing stage. In line with customer requirements, specific custom moisture values in the range of 4%–15% can also be achieved.
Operating Principle of Drying Ovens
At Alesta Naturel facilities, the drying process is carried out in continuous-flow (roller) drying ovens. Veneer sheets are passed through the oven via a belt system. The temperature, airflow, and passage speed inside the oven are precisely adjusted according to the wood species and veneer thickness. While hot air rapidly removes moisture from the veneer surface, moisture and temperature are continuously monitored to prevent over-drying.
The Importance of Drying Parameters
Each wood species requires a different drying temperature and duration. Beech veneer requires a longer drying time due to its denser structure, while poplar veneer dries more quickly. If the drying temperature is too high, cracking and color changes may occur on the veneer surface. If it remains too low, sufficient moisture cannot be removed and bonding quality decreases. For this reason, optimum drying parameters are carefully determined and applied for each batch.
Post-Drying Quality Control
After the drying process, veneer sheets are checked with moisture measuring devices. Sheets outside the target moisture range are returned for re-drying or set aside. Veneer sheets that pass quality control are sorted and prepared for the gluing and pressing stage.

Does the drying duration vary by wood species?
Yes, since the density and moisture content of each wood species differ, the drying duration and temperature also vary. Hardwoods such as beech require a longer drying time, while softwoods such as poplar can dry in as little as 20 minutes.
-
What is the effect of improper drying on plywood quality?
In the case of insufficient drying, the adhesive cannot penetrate properly, and moisture evaporating during pressing causes blistering and delamination in the panel. With excessive drying, cracking and color changes appear on the veneer surface and bonding strength decreases.
